Who are the Florham Park Jaycees?

Formed on May 3, 1967, the Florham Park Jaycees have always strived to be a positive and active force in shaping the culture and attractiveness of the Borough of Florham Park in Morris County, New Jersey. Comprised of approximately seventy (70) member families (and growing) in the Florham Park/Morris County area, the Jaycees are a community service and charitable organization of skilled and professional individuals from all walks of life, who donate their time and resources to the Florham Park area community.
